Trilaciclib Injections are treatments created to safeguard hematopoietic stem cells and immune system functions against the harmful effects of chemotherapy treatment. Clinical applications of this groundbreaking development are predominantly seen in treating small cell lung cancer triple negative breast cancer and colorectal cancer. Trilaciclib Injections offer effectiveness and minimal adverse reactions making them highly sought after in the healthcare industry.

Applications of Trilaciclib Injections in Oncology Therapies, Advanced Medical Research & Palliative Care
Trilaciclib Injections are extensively used in the field of oncology, primarily in the treatment of small cell lung cancer. As a cyclin-dependent kinase inhibitor, this medication prevents DNA damage in healthy cells during chemotherapy, hence exhibiting unique advantages in preserving patient health during cancer therapies. Outside oncology, Trilaciclib Injections also play a crucial role in palliative care, managing side effects related to advanced stages of cancer. Its potential to protect the immune system during chemotherapy significantly reduces the symptoms associated with cancer treatments, leading to improved patient quality of life.
